The Quintana Roo Government, via the Ministry of Economic Development (SEDE), is inviting craft cooperatives and social groups to participate in the Handicraft Diversification and Marketing Program 2025. The program aims to bolster the commercial aspects of craft workshops by offering financial assistance in three stages. These stages include renovating workshop spaces, purchasing commercial equipment, creating signage, and establishing areas for displaying and selling crafts.

This initiative is part of the New Agreement for the Welfare and Development of Quintana Roo, championed by Governor Mara Lezama Espinosa. The agreement's goal is to reduce inequality and transform the state, particularly the original Mayan towns. The financial assistance is available to social groups or cooperatives that operate workshops where craft products are sold collectively. These workshops should be located in Quintana Roo or in areas bordering other states.

Eligible participants are individuals who create crafts such as textiles, embroidery, frayed clothing, woodwork, vegetable fiber crafts, and marine material crafts. Preference will be given to those located in rural areas who have not received government support in the current fiscal year. Selected groups will receive financial assistance of up to 120,000 pesos in three stages. This funding will be used to enhance workshop spaces, purchase commercial equipment, create signage, and develop promotional materials. Interested parties can contact the provided phone numbers for more information and to apply. The opportunity to apply will remain open throughout the fiscal year 2025.
